NKJ - Nordic Joint Committee for Agricultural Research
Applications for NKJ grants
The Nordic Joint Committee for Agricultural Research (NKJ) is made up by the agricultural research councils in the five Nordic countries. The task of NKJ is to act in an advisory capacity for the Nordic Council of Ministers (NMR) and to recommend finance for research of joint Nordic interest. NKJ has no funds of its own, but can recommend that the research councils, or NMR, provide grants for research programmes.
A grant for a research project of joint Nordic interest can be given when at least three (in exceptional cases, two) Nordic countries participate in the project. After a grant is allocated on the recommendation of NKJ, funds for the project are made available by the research councils in the countries concerned.
NKJ can recommend a grant for
- research projects
- preliminary studies for a major project
- networking activities (meetings of researchers, symposia, conferences, etc)
Applications for research projects shall be submitted to the secretariat of NKJ no later than 1 June, and for networking activities no later than 15 August.
